Hi,

I have a hero with 2.73.468.74

I want to use custom roms.

when Installing the patched recovery image , I get downloading 'boot.img'... FAILED (remote: not allow) error.

solution seems to be flashrec, but I cant install it to, my htc hero does not have a file manager.

also does not have android market, so I cant download a file manager.

actually I want to use custom roms for use the market and other applications.

ps: I've tried diffrent country stock roms but, I cant upgrade or downgrade.

any idea?

Well, the 405.5 ROM I was suggesting to downgrade is 2.73.405.5 which is a 2.73.x.x ROM

Newer 2.73 series stock ROM's (like the Turkish one I'm speaking of, or the TMO version) does have problems with flashrec as well.

Speaking of experience, the only way for me to root my 2.73.468.x ROM, was the Gold Card method to downgrade to 2.73.405.5 and then use flashrec.
